Why does my hyundai i40 release vibrations when accelerating?

So let’s begin our guideline with the roots of this form of trouble on your car. You should already know that an engine, especially if it is old or if it has been driven a lot, can naturally vibrate without being a trouble behind it. Large diesel engines, especially those with a lot of torque, can trigger this kind of impression, both at idle and when accelerating.

I feel vibrations on my hyundai i40 only when accelerating

Let’s take the most interesting circumstance for us in this guideline. The fact that you come to feel trembling on your hyundai i40 during your acceleration periods, in this scenario you will have to check the condition of different parts because several of elements can be at the beginning of these vibrations and even if you are unfortunate a mix of several of them may also be possible, here is the list of components that can be involved.

  • Turbo: If the turbo of your hyundai i40 is faulty, it may trigger vibrations that you will come to feel when you accelerate at the moment it is turned on.
  • The turbo pressure sensor: This sensor will manage the pressure exerted in the turbo of your car, if it fails it may bother the behavior of your turbo and generate vibrations that you may feel at the time of acceleration of your hyundai i40.

I’m having vibrations on my hyundai i40 at acceleration and deceleration

We will now look into the scenario where you feel vibrations on your hyundai i40 when you are accelerating but also when you are idling. If you only feel vibrations when you are idling on your hyundai i40, please consult our guideline focused upon this trouble to fix your problem. If, however, you realize that your hyundai i40 vibrates when accelerating but also when it is stopped, here is the list of items to examine:

  • EGR valve: In reality this valve which handles the return of exhaust gases for pollution standards can become dirty and disturb the evacuation of exhaust gases which can trigger hyundai i40 vibrates when accelerating but also when stopped.
  • Injectors: Your injectors that regulating the fuel/air mixture flow may be dirty or damaged, which will bring out the wrong amount of mixture and thus prevent your engine block from working properly, it is even possible that one or more of your cylinders are not running effectively.
  • Fuel Filter: Like the injectors, if the filter is clogged it will not let the fuel pass effectively and therefore disturb the performance of your hyundai i40, up to the point of leading to vibrations during acceleration.

What can I do to stop the vibration when I accelerate on my hyundai i40? What can I do?

Finally, in this last part, we will provide you the answers available to you to cure these tremors on your car when you accelerate. Here is the best attitude to adopt depending on the part that is involved:

  • Turbo: If your turbo starts all these vibrations when you accelerate your hyundai i40, it will be good for you to control all the components associated with it because changing a complete turbo is a big budget and in most cases the trouble does not come specifically from the turbo. So remember to examine your turbo pressure sensor, your flowmeter, the EGR valve and the hoses of your turbo. Otherwise take your hyundai i40 to your garage area.
  • EGR valve: The EGR valve has the benefit that it is often times easy to access and simple to take apart/clean. You can always examine it and clean it, for this see our guideline on cleaning the EGR valve of an hyundai i40.
  • Injectors: Injectors are very delicate components and a few impurities may be enough to disturb their performance. Use a fuel additive to simply clean the injectors, if this is not enough you will have to go to a professional.
  • Fuel Filter: If it is the fuel filter, only replace it. A fuel filter doesn’t clean itself, so if it is clogged you will basically have to replace it with a new one.
